On our recent cruise to MoBay we did a tour and requested "local food". Our driver took us to Scotchies. The pork and chicken was the best I've ever eaten! We had 1/4 pork and 1/4 chicken, red beans and rice and festival, water and a coke. Our bill was $14.00. Highly, highly recommend!
